bom dia galera, tó aperriando aki mais uma vez.
a dúvida é a seguinte, tó criando um form com opções para fazer pesquisa e estou usando o checkbox quando marcar a checkbox gostaria que fosse exibido por exemplo uma textbox para poder preencher com a informação que fosse ser pesquisado. Se alguem puder me explicar como faço, fico muito agradecido.
Como Tornar Objetos Visivéis?
Started By Wanderley Patricio, 01/10/2009, 07:56
3 replies to this topic
#1
Posted 01/10/2009, 07:56
#2
Posted 02/10/2009, 08:43
O Wanderley, isso é muito fácil meu velho.
Pense um pouco, quando marcado o checkBox você quer mostrar o textBox ok?
Programe a rotina do checkBox "OnChecked" para setar como true a properties Visible do seu textBox.
* Por padrão esse textBox deve ser Visible = false;
Qualquer dúvida (que eu acredito que não haverá) reporte.
Um abraço
Pense um pouco, quando marcado o checkBox você quer mostrar o textBox ok?
Programe a rotina do checkBox "OnChecked" para setar como true a properties Visible do seu textBox.
* Por padrão esse textBox deve ser Visible = false;
Qualquer dúvida (que eu acredito que não haverá) reporte.
Um abraço
#3
Posted 07/10/2009, 14:10
#KautZmanN# agradeço a sua dis posição em sempre ajudar. a resposta a esse tópico ja encontrei, bem como vc citou.
o código abaixo mostra bem o que fiz.
if (checkBox5.Checked == true)
{
label1.Visible = true;
comboBox1.Visible = true;
try
{
//define o comando sql para selecionar os dados das tabela Clientes
FbCommand sql = new FbCommand();
sql.Connection = cnn;
sql.CommandText = "SELECT * from BACTERIOLOGICA";
//cria um adapter para preencher um dataset
FbDataAdapter da = new FbDataAdapter(sql);
//define um objeto DataSet
DataSet ds = new DataSet();
//abre a conexão
cnn.Open();
da.Fill(ds,"BACTERIOLOGICA");
//atribui o dataset ao DataSource do BindingSource
comboBox1.DataSource = ds.Tables["BACTERIOLOGICA"];
comboBox1.DisplayMember = "COLETADO_POR";
comboBox1.ValueMember = "NUM_AMOSTRA";
comboBox1.SelectedIndex = 0;
}
catch (Exception)
{
MessageBox.Show("erro ao obter os dados.");
}
finally
{
cnn.Close();
}
}
else
{
label1.Visible = false;
comboBox1.Visible = false;
}
o código abaixo mostra bem o que fiz.
if (checkBox5.Checked == true)
{
label1.Visible = true;
comboBox1.Visible = true;
try
{
//define o comando sql para selecionar os dados das tabela Clientes
FbCommand sql = new FbCommand();
sql.Connection = cnn;
sql.CommandText = "SELECT * from BACTERIOLOGICA";
//cria um adapter para preencher um dataset
FbDataAdapter da = new FbDataAdapter(sql);
//define um objeto DataSet
DataSet ds = new DataSet();
//abre a conexão
cnn.Open();
da.Fill(ds,"BACTERIOLOGICA");
//atribui o dataset ao DataSource do BindingSource
comboBox1.DataSource = ds.Tables["BACTERIOLOGICA"];
comboBox1.DisplayMember = "COLETADO_POR";
comboBox1.ValueMember = "NUM_AMOSTRA";
comboBox1.SelectedIndex = 0;
}
catch (Exception)
{
MessageBox.Show("erro ao obter os dados.");
}
finally
{
cnn.Close();
}
}
else
{
label1.Visible = false;
comboBox1.Visible = false;
}
#4
Posted 08/10/2009, 08:25
Show, fico feliz que deu certo.
É sempre bom após solucionado tu postar seu code, pode ajudar outras pessoas.
Um abraço
É sempre bom após solucionado tu postar seu code, pode ajudar outras pessoas.
Um abraço
0 user(s) are reading this topic
0 membro(s), 0 visitante(s) e 0 membros anônimo(s)